Sort By
2023 BMW 1 Series
M135i xDrive 5dr Step Auto
M135i xDrive 5dr Step Auto
Dick Lovett BMW Bristol - 116 miles away
3,000 miles
Request callback
£37,150
2021 BMW 1 Series
2.0 M135i Hatchback 5dr Petrol Auto xDrive Euro 6 (s/s) (306 ps)
2.0 M135i Hatchback 5dr Petrol Auto xDrive Euro 6 (s/s) (306 ps)
MotorClass - 117 miles away
22,767 miles
Request callback
£35,994
2024 BMW 1 Series
2.0 M135i Hatchback 5dr Petrol DCT xDrive Euro 6 (s/s) (300 ps)
2.0 M135i Hatchback 5dr Petrol DCT xDrive Euro 6 (s/s) (300 ps)
MotorClass - 117 miles away
1,886 miles
Request callback
£40,995
2020 BMW 1 Series
M135i xDrive 5dr Step Auto
M135i xDrive 5dr Step Auto
Mercedes-Benz of Blackburn - 120 miles away
27,985 miles
Request callback
£25,868
2020 BMW 1 Series
2.0 M135i Hatchback 5dr Petrol Auto xDrive Euro 6 (s/s) (306 ps)
2.0 M135i Hatchback 5dr Petrol Auto xDrive Euro 6 (s/s) (306 ps)
Wavertree Car Centre Ltd - 121 miles away
66,347 miles
Request callback
£19,995
2023 BMW 1 Series
M135i xDrive 5dr Step Auto
M135i xDrive 5dr Step Auto
CarSupermarket.com Preston - 129 miles away
21,601 miles
Request callback
£28,197
2019 BMW 1 Series
M135i xDrive 5dr Step Auto
M135i xDrive 5dr Step Auto
Marshall BMW Bournemouth - 138 miles away
26,353 miles
Request callback
£23,501
2022 BMW 1 Series
2.0 M135i 5dr Auto xDrive (SAT NAV, PRIVACY GLASS)
2.0 M135i 5dr Auto xDrive (SAT NAV, PRIVACY GLASS)
Jeff White Motors - 138 miles away
37,153 miles
Request callback
£24,988
2023 BMW 1 Series
M135i xDrive 5dr Step Auto
M135i xDrive 5dr Step Auto
Vertu Bmw Yeovil - 145 miles away
26,394 miles
Request callback
£29,838
2024 BMW 1 Series
M135i xDrive 5dr Step Auto
M135i xDrive 5dr Step Auto
Vertu BMW Teesside - 145 miles away
3,896 miles
Request callback
£32,500
2023 BMW 1 Series
M135i xDrive 5dr Step Auto
M135i xDrive 5dr Step Auto
Vertu Bmw Bridgwater - 147 miles away
24,201 miles
Request callback
£30,082
2022 BMW 1 Series
2.0 M135i Hatchback 5dr Petrol Auto xDrive Euro 6 (s/s) (306 ps)
2.0 M135i Hatchback 5dr Petrol Auto xDrive Euro 6 (s/s) (306 ps)
Wearside Autoparc Sunderland - 170 miles away
10,737 miles
Request callback
£28,499
2023 BMW 1 Series
M135i xDrive 5dr Step Auto
M135i xDrive 5dr Step Auto
Vertu BMW Sunderland - 173 miles away
23,857 miles
Request callback
£29,664
2024 BMW 1 Series
M135i xDrive 5dr Step Auto
M135i xDrive 5dr Step Auto
Vertu BMW Sunderland - 173 miles away
9,201 miles
Request callback
£32,969
2019 BMW 1 Series
M135i xDrive 5dr Step Auto
M135i xDrive 5dr Step Auto
Vertu Bmw Exeter - 183 miles away
43,416 miles
Request callback
£24,495
Buy new from | £28,702 | (list price from £31,875) |
Showing 46 - 60 of 76 cars